Transaction 3768987bcae2e34f4f1255c0cc9251c893516ad86c289b60defbd1bd419f9750
1 Input
1 Output
-
3768987bcae2e34f4f1255c0cc9251c893516ad86c289b60defbd1bd419f9750:0
- value
- 397223
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5cfc656f3aeeb840c70f62275ccd4d136c6a360
- address
- bc1q6h8uv4hn4m4cgrrs7c38tnx56ymvdgmq5u2fyv